"Overstroming en evacuatie" (Flood and Evacuation), a print created in 1873 by Belgian artist Edgar Alfred Baes, depicts a somber scene of a flooded landscape. The print uses subtle shading to create a sense of depth and realism, highlighting the impact of the flood on the small houses and the lone figures trying to evacuate. Baes's work, while often depicting rural scenes, often carried a melancholic undertone, as seen in this piece. The print's small size adds to the intimacy of the scene, allowing viewers to connect with the struggle of those caught in the flood.
